Registered Nurse (RN) Fellow Job Responsibilities
- Achieves patient outcomes and enhances experience through focused, integrated care delivery.
- Practices in assigned settings, meets program objectives, and applies new knowledge under direct RN supervision.
- Performs patient assessments to collect data, following care plans, guidelines, and pathways under supervision.
- Uses assessment data and patient preferences to identify care needs.
- Organizes, prioritizes, and delivers patient care using Inova’s Nursing Professional Practice Model.
- Monitors patient progress and adjusts care plans to achieve outcomes.
- Provides compassionate, empathetic care while ensuring patient privacy and confidentiality.
- Bases clinical decisions on knowledge, principles, and evidence-based practices.
- Works efficiently with the healthcare team to achieve productivity and outcomes.
- Documents patient care activities accurately, seeking assistance to improve documentation skills.
- Actively participates in multidisciplinary rounds and team meetings.
- Integrates novice nursing abilities with new knowledge to deliver safe, high-quality care.
- Seeks resources and validation from healthcare team members to enhance clinical practice.
- Open to feedback, mentoring, and suggestions to improve care.
- Attends all learning sessions, completes assignments on time, and applies knowledge in clinical settings.
- Willing to learn new skills, demonstrate reasoning, and use equipment for effective care.
- May serve as a preceptor after completing orientation and competency.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
